A baby is hypotonic and shows increased ratio of Pyruvate to Acetyl CoA. Pyruvate cannot form Acetyl CoA in fibroblast. He also shows features of lactic acidosis. Which of the following can revert the situation?

Correct Answer: Thiamin
Description: Ans. D. ThiaminIncreased Pyruvate to Acetyl-CoA, with lactic acidosis, inability to convert Pyruvate to Acetyl-CoA are all suggestive of a Pyruvate Dehydrogenase deficiency. Thiamine Pyrophosphate is one of the coenzymes of PDH. Hence Thiamine is the answer.
